Output 764094481316effa8539dff25abd164f40db4e90ffa2fa84c9c3527b3087020a:1

value
189536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d3bf95e265242242fffb1f78f4e0043ff26f0d OP_EQUAL
address
3FFwbUDcLonsYpq71wCbeTU2EtE1qA6c8s
transaction
764094481316effa8539dff25abd164f40db4e90ffa2fa84c9c3527b3087020a
spent
true